Colruyt Group
Colruyt Group is a Belgian family-owned retail corporation founded in 1928 and headquartered in Halle, Belgium. The company operates over 500 stores across Belgium, France, Luxembourg, and the Netherlands, employing more than 33,000 people. With a turnover of approximately �7.96 billion in 2020, Colruyt Group is recognized for its discount supermarket chain, Colruyt, which competes with other retailers like Aldi and Lidl.
In addition to Colruyt, the group has a diverse portfolio of brands, including OKay, Bio-Planet, Cru, Dreamland, Dreambaby, SPAR, Coccinelle, and Fiets!. Colruyt Group also engages in wholesale, foodservice, and fuel retailing, operating unmanned filling stations under the DATS 24 brand. The company emphasizes low prices, sustainability, and innovation, being a pioneer in barcode scanning for stock management and environmental initiatives.
Colruyt Group is committed to providing value, quality, and sustainability, serving both individual consumers and business clients. The company also invests in education through the Colruyt Group Academy, offering training programs for employees and customers.
